We are seeking a reliable and vigilant Relief Security Operations Centre Operator to support a busy security control room in Cambridge, CB21. This role is responsible for monitoring site security systems, responding to incidents and maintaining a calm, professional approach in a fast-paced environment. You will work as part of a wider security team, providing operational cover across a range of shifts, including days, nights, weekends and public holidays.

Key responsibilities will include monitoring CCTV, alarms, access control systems and other security technology; receiving and assessing incident reports; contacting relevant emergency services or on-site personnel when required; and accurately recording all activity in daily occurrence logs and electronic reporting systems. You will manage communications professionally, follow agreed escalation procedures, conduct regular system checks and help ensure that all security incidents are handled promptly and appropriately. The role may also involve issuing instructions to mobile officers, coordinating responses, monitoring access and assisting with investigations by reviewing footage or producing incident information.

Applicants should have previous experience in a security, control room, monitoring or customer-focused operational environment, although full training may be provided for candidates who demonstrate the right skills and attitude. A valid security licence appropriate to control room duties is desirable, along with experience using CCTV, radio communication and computer-based reporting systems. You must have strong attention to detail, clear written and verbal communication skills, good IT ability and the confidence to make sound decisions under pressure. Flexibility, reliability and a professional approach are essential, as is the ability to maintain confidentiality and follow procedures consistently. Successful candidates will be required to complete relevant screening and background checks before appointment.
